Prof. Mickey Davis is right -- a license is a "unilateral contract" which derives meaning and force from contact law.
Richard Stallman is right -- GPL licensors do not claim that licensees have made any promises in return.
And Prof. Eben Moglen is right -- the GPL does not require contract enforcement in order to work.
